Work on language comprehension at their thinking level.Ultimately,dyslexics will be able to read text on their own-but until then,make comprehension a “print-less” activity.Keep them intellectually engaged,learning vocab. & not guessing at words they can’t decode. #ogwinter2021.

"One of the most exciting outcomes of dyslexia research is the firm conclusion that with early identification and appropriate instruction it is possible to 'overcome' dyslexia (Shaywitz, 2003) or even 'prevent' it (Fletcher, et al., 2019; Gaab, 2019)." Hasbrouck, in press.

CA Class action suit settled last week #jeffersoncounty2og2021 requiring a school district to only use literacy programs that follow the Science of Reading-cannot use Fountas & Pinnell Leveled Literacy or Reading Recovery. #arethereadingwarsover #canwestopfightingandendilliteracy
Requires BUSD to universally screen for risk of dyslexia, supplement its core curriculum to include phonics & PA instruction, adopt reading intervention programs aligned with the Science Of Reading🧵.#dyslexia #CAdyslexialawsuit #UniversalScreening #SB237.
